The UDFCD staff worked <br />directly with all of the affected commwlities during the course of the study and received input and <br />endorsement for the study methods and results. CWCB staff concurs with the UDFCD request for <br />designation and approval of the study. <br /> <br />Staff findings: CWCB staff has determined that the subject 100-year detailed floodplain information for <br />the studied stream reaches is conformance with the CWCB' s rules and regulations for floodplain <br />designation and approval. The CWCB endorses this study as containing the most current floodplain <br />mapping available and urges the affected commwlities to adopt said study for land use regulation purposes <br />pursuant to statutory authority. <br /> <br />Staff recommendation: Staff recommends that the Board: 1) designate and approve the 100-year <br />detailed floodplain information contained in said report for Little Dry Creek and Tributaries, and 2) <br />authorize staff to prepare a floodplain resolution to be signed by the Director and transmitted to <br />FEMA, the Urban Drainage and Flood Control District, Arapahoe County, City and COWlty of Denver, <br />Greenwood Village, Cheny Hills Village, and City of Littleton. This action is recommended in order to <br />meet statutory requirements. <br /> <br />Flood Protection. Water Project Planning and Financing.
